Steam generators are heat exchangers used to convert water into steam from heat produced in a nuclear reactor core They are used in pressurized water reactors between the primary and secondary coolant loops In typical PWR designs, the primary coolant is highpurity water, kept under high pressure so it cannot boil This primary coolant is pumped through the reactor core where it absorbs heat from the fuel rods It then passes through the steam generator, where it transfers its heat to lowerpr.

In a power plant, the steam turbine is attached to a generator to produce electrical power The turbine acts as the more mechanical side of the system by providing the rotary motion for the generator, while the generator acts as the electrical side by employing the laws of electricity and magnetism to produce electrical power In a steam turbine rotor is the spinning component that has wheels and blades attached to it. In thermal power plants, there is usually one main generator, which provides all of the power for electric power grids A steam turbine is usually on the same shaft with a main generator and an exciter In general, a main generator consists of a rotating part and a stationary part Stator Stator is the stationary part of an electric generator, which surrounds the rotor The stator has a wire winding in which the changing field induces an electric current;.

A steam power plant must have following equipment (a) A furnace to burn the fuel (b) Steam generator or boiler containing water Heat generated in the furnace is utilized to convert water into steam (c) Main power unit such as an engine or turbine to use the heat energy of steam and perform work. The steamelectric power station is a power station in which the electric generator is steam driven Water is heated, turns into steam and spins a steam turbine which drives an electrical generator After it passes through the turbine, the steam is condensed in a condenser The greatest variation in the design of steamelectric power plants is due to the different fuel sources. Steam generators (SGs) are nuclear power plant components (NPPs) in which the steam, driving the turbine, is produced They are heat exchangers where the heat produced in the reactor core is transferred to the secondary side, the steam system, of the nuclear power plant. 633 Heat Recovery Steam Generator (HRSG) Heat recovery steam generator is a highefficiency steam boiler that uses hot gases from a gas turbine for reciprocating engine to generate steam in a thermodynamic Rankine Cycle This system is able to generate steam at different pressure levels according to chemical process requirements (PGTHERMAL, 09) HSRG system can use single, double, or even triple pressure levels, and choosing one configuration over other relies on process requirements. Turbine Generator – Power Conversion System The layout of nuclear power plants comprises two major parts The nuclear island and the conventional (turbine) islandThe nuclear island is the heart of the nuclear power plant On the other hand the conventional (turbine) island houses the key component which extracts thermal energy from pressurized steam and converts it into electrical energy.
